#641a9c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#641a9c is composed of 39.2% red, 10.2%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.9% cyan, 83.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 274.2 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 35.7%. #641a9c color hex could be obtained by blending #c834ff with #000039.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#641a9c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030105 is the darkest color, while #f9f3f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#641a9c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b595d is the less saturated color, while #6705b1 is the most saturated one.
